6.1.2 RESETTING THE RESET TOTAL
The reset total resetting operation can only be performed after resetting the
partial register. The reset total can in fact be reset by pressing the reset key at
length while the display screen shows reset total as on the following display
page:
Schematically, the steps to be taken are:
1
Wait for the display to show normal standby display page (with total only dis-
played)
2 Press the reset key quickly
3 The meter starts to reset the partial
4 While the display page showing the reset total is displayed
Press the reset key again for at least 1 second
5 The display screen again shows all the segments of the display followed by all
the switched-off segments and finally shows the display page where the reset
Reset Total is shown.
6.2 DISPENSING IN FLOW RATE MODE
FOREWORD
It is possible to dispense, displaying at the same time:
- the dispensed partial
- the Flow Rate in [Partial Unit / minute] as shown on the following
display page:
Procedure for
entering this
mode:
- wait for the meter to go to Standby, meaning the display screen shows Total only
- quickly press the CAL key.
- Start dispensing
The flow rate is updated every 0.7 seconds. Consequently, the display could be relatively
unstable at lower flow rates. The higher the flow rate, the more stable the displayed value.
ATTENTION
The flow rate is measured with reference to the unit of measurement of the Par-
tial. For this reason, in case of the unit of measurement of the Partial and Total
being different, as in the example shown below, it should be remembered that
the indicated flow rate relates to the unit of measurement of the partial. In the
example shown, the flow rate is expressed in Qts/min.
The word “Gal” remaining alongside the flow rate refers to the register of
the Totals ( Reset or NON Reset) which are again displayed when exiting
from the flow rate reading mode.
To return to “Normal” mode, press the CAL key again. If one of the
two keys RESET or CAL is accidentally pressed during the count,
this will have no effect.
.
ATTENTION Even though in this mode they are not displayed, both the Reset Total
and the General Total (Total) increase. Their value can be checked
after dispensing has terminated, returning to “Normal” mode, by
quickly pressing CAL.
